Early Life and Education
Born on September 21, 1962, in New Rochelle, New York, United States, Morrow went to Miami Sunset High School. Unfortunately, he dropped out at the beginning of his senior year to begin his acting career.
Rise to Fame and Breakthrough Moment
- Morrow’s film career started when he appeared as an extra at age 18 on Saturday Night Live.
- He co-starred alongside Johnny Depp in Private Resort (1985) and thereafter appeared in the Dentyne gum commercials where he would slyly utter the “Time to walk the dog” catch phrase.

Rob Morrow Family, Parents
Morrow was born in New Rochelle, New York, United States as the son of Diane Francis (mother) and Murray Morrow (father). Diane Francis was a dental hygienist, while Murray Morrow, an industrial lighting manufacturer. Unfortunately, his parents divorced when he was nine years old.
Rob Morrow Siblings
Morrow has a sister named Carrie Morrow.
Rob Morrow Wife
Morrow is currently married to Debbon Ayer, an actress and producer, known for Eternal Sunshine of the Spotless Mind. The couple tied the knot in October 1998. Marrow and Debbon Ayer have been blessed with a daughter named Tu Simone Ayer Morrow. Tu Simone Ayer Morrow was born on April 25, 2005. Currently, Morrow lives in Los Angeles, CA, USA, with his family.

Northern Exposure
Morrow starred as Dr. Joel Fleischman in Northern Exposure. Northern Exposure was an American comedy-drama television series about the eccentric residents in the fictitious town of Cicely, Alaska, that originally aired on CBS from July 12, 1990, to July 26, 1995, with a total of 110 episodes.
It received 57 award nominations during its six-season run and won 27, including the 1992 Primetime Emmy Award for Outstanding Drama Series, two additional Primetime Emmy Awards, four Creative Arts Emmy Awards, and two Golden Globes.
Private Resort
Morrow starred as Ben in Private Resort. Private Resort was a 1985 American adventure comedy film directed by George Bowers and written by Gordon Mitchell, Ken Segall, and Alan Wenkus. The film starred Morrow, Johnny Depp, Hector Elizondo, Dody Goodman, Tony Azito, and Leslie Easterbrook.
